- What does US — real estate investment property net mean?
- This metric reflects the net book value of healthcare-related real estate assets held within the United States segment after accounting for accumulated depreciation and impairment charges. It represents the capital base invested in medical office buildings, hospitals, and senior housing facilities. Investors use this to assess the size and quality of the company's domestic asset base and its potential for future income generation.
